Karen Gevorkian

Karen Gevorkian (born 1941) is a Soviet film director and screenwriter.

Also recorded as Karen Gevorkyan.

Contents

Overview

Born at Yerevan in 1941.

In detail

Karen Gevorkian studied at Gerasimov Institute of Cinematography and Top Courses for Scriptwriters and Film Directors. the recorded working language is Armenian.

Employment is recorded with Armenfilm, Mosfilm and Tsentrnauchfilm. Membership is recorded of Union of Cinematographers of Armenia.
